2-Butoxy-1,5-di-tert-butyl-3-iodo-benzene (3.88 g, 10 mmol) was dissolved in anhydrous 1,2-dimethoxy-ethane (55 mL under a nitrogen atmosphere. The solution was cooled to −75° C. and t-butyl lithium (14.7 mL, 25 mmol, 1.7M in pentane) was added dropwise over 20-25 min at −72° C. to −69° C. The reaction was stirred at −72° C. for 45 min and then treated with trimethyl borate (5.7 mL, 50 mmol). The reaction was kept cold for 1 h and then the bath was removed and the reaction allowed to warm to room temperature over 24 h. It was treated with 1N hydrochloric acid (35 mL) and stirred for 30 min. The reaction was then diluted with water (200 mL) and extracted with ethyl acetate (150 mL, 2×100 mL). The combined organic portions were washed with bicarbonate solution (100 mL), water (150 mL), brine (150 mL), dried (Na2SO4), filtered and evaporated in vacuo to provide 3.0 g of an oil. The material was purified by flash chromotography (eluet: (9:1) hexane:ethyl acetate and (4:1) hexane:ethyl acetate) to provide 2.04 g (67%) of a white solid. Mp: 82-91° C. 1H NMR (250 MHz, CDCl3): δ 7.66 (d, 1H, J=2.6), 7.48 (d, 1H, J=2.6), 5.75 (s, 1H), 3.84 (t, 2H, J=7.1), 1.84 (m, 2H), 1.47 (m, 2H), 1.42 (s, 9H), 1.33 (s, 9H), 2.66 (t, 3H, J=7.3). MS [EI+] 307 (M+H)+[EI−] 305 (M−H)+.
